Leptin
A hormone produced by adipose (fat) cells that helps to regulate energy balance by inhibiting hunger, thereby influencing body weight and fat mass.
Orexin
A neuropeptide that regulates arousal, wakefulness, and appetite.
Embryo
An early stage of development in multicellular organisms after fertilization, during which the organism undergoes rapid cell division and differentiation.
Toxins
Substances that are poisonous or harmful to organisms, produced naturally by living things or created artificially.
